An excellent opportunity has become available for an Accountant to join this stable organisation who pride themselves on low staff turnover. This role has become available due to an internal relocator. The role will report directly into the Finance Director and will provide them with day to day accounting support as well as working on other business critical projects as required.

Key duties:

  • Preparation of monthly accounts
  • Assist with audit preparation
  • VAT and Corporation tax
  • Balance sheet reconciliations
  • Manage customer contracts and queries
  • Company insurance monitoring
  • Sales analysis
  • Other ad hoc duties and projects as required

Key skills and attributes:

  • Proven track record in a similar role
  • Experience of Corporation tax is essential
  • Professional, hardworking and strong communicator
  • Excellent Excel skills is a must
